What Affects Your Price

POS & Online Ordering Integration

Deep integration with Toast or Square for real-time inventory and pickup times increases setup complexity but reduces manual entry errors.

Catering Automation Logic

Custom forms that calculate estimated costs based on guest count and distance can significantly increase the initial build price but save hours of admin time.

Live Location APIs

Integrating with services like Best Food Trucks or custom GPS pings to show your live location on a map requires specialized API configuration.

High-Resolution Media

Professional food photography and video headers are essential for conversion; sourcing or optimizing these assets affects the creative budget.

SEO for Local Discovery

Ranking for 'Food Truck Catering [City]' requires specific schema markup and localized landing pages, which adds to the initial labor.

Common Mistakes When Evaluating Cost

Using PDF Menus

PDFs are invisible to Google Search and difficult to read on mobile devices. Always use web-based, schema-marked menus.

Hidden Contact Information

Catering clients are often in a rush. If they can't find a 'Book Catering' button within 5 seconds, they will move to the next truck.

Ignoring Local SEO

Failing to optimize for your specific service area means you lose out on 'food truck near me' searches which drive daily foot traffic.

No Calendar Updates

A website showing a schedule from three months ago signals to customers that the business may be inactive.

FAQ

Should I use Square or Toast for my food truck website?

Square is excellent for lower-volume trucks due to its ease of use, while Toast offers more robust inventory and multi-location features for high-volume fleets.
